Has online information become a commodity? Are we buying information by the liter? For decades, information professionals have been addressing the IAOTWFF (It's All On The Web For Free) phenomenon by emphasizing the unreliability and impermanence of information on the web. We would talk about the difficulty of conducting complex searches, the inability of search engines to index much of the content on the web, and the lack of historical depth: We portrayed the web as a mile wide and an inch deep.
